One of Florida’s most iconic resorts, with a distinctive ‘country club’ atmosphere

Originally opened in 1926, this much-loved resort has benefited from an extensive programme of renovations, being reborn as a luxury resort with every facility you could ever want. Its five distinctive properties range from the historic ‘Cloister’ building, still the beating heart of the resort to this day, through the Tower, Bungalows, the adults-only Yacht Club and the sleek and stylish Beach Club. The resort’s eight restaurants offer everything from market-fresh sushi at the Beach Club Lounge to sizzling steaks at the Flamingo Grill, and from handmade pasta at Principessa Ristorante to all-American classics at Mulligans.

Those with an active interest in sports and fitness are well catered for at The Boca Raton, with bike rentals, yoga, gym, a full range of watersports and no fewer than 16 tennis courts. Golfers, in particular, will relish the opportunity to tee off on the exceptional 18-hole championship golf course, complete with its signature island green finishing hole, a driving range, pro shop and an all-important clubhouse.

Anyone more interested in embarking on a wellness journey might prefer the world-class Spa Palmera, where the architecture and courtyard gardens are inspired by the Alhambra Palace. In its 44 treatment rooms you can enjoy a range of therapies designed to revitalise the body, face and mind, before relaxing in a range of saunas, steam rooms and ritual baths.

Accommodation

1,047 rooms and suites are situated across five separate parts of the resort – choose from the historic Cloister, the adults-only Yacht Club, the stylish Beach Club, the fully renovated Tower and the standalone Bungalows. While each part has its own unique style, all rooms promise beautiful design and furnishings, and ample space to relax. Local Area

The Boca Raton has an enviable location on Florida’s Atlantic Coast, midway between the exclusive resorts of Fort Lauderdale and Palm Beach, and about 35 minutes’ drive north of Fort Lauderdale Airport or an hour’s drive from Miami Airport.

The five parts of the resort straddle either side of Lake Boca Raton, an inlet from the sea which forms part of Florida’s Intracoastal Waterway. As the name suggests, the Beach Club sits on the ocean-facing side of the lake, while the other four sections – the Cloister, Yacht Club, Tower and Bungalows, sit on the harbour side of the lake.

The town of Boca Raton – or simply ‘Boca’ to the locals – is focused around Mizner Park, the downtown shopping, dining and entertainment district. More upscale shopping can be enjoyed at Town Center, while a couple of offbeat attractions that might pique your interest would be the incredible collection of Broadway costumes at the Wick Museum, or admiring the wildlife while strolling the boardwalks at Daggerwing Nature Center
